THE RAYMOND WENTZ FOUNDATION RECEIVES GRANT FROM THE KOMEN DENVER AFFILIATE TO OFFER HOPE FOR TOMORROW THROUGH THE JOYS OF TODAYDenver, CO – April 10, 2009 – The Denver Affiliate of Susan G. Komen for the Cure® has awarded a $42,000 grant to The Raymond Wentz Foundation in order to make a difference in the lives of medically underserved breast cancer patients. At The Raymond Wentz Foundation, the grant from Komen for the Cure will support low income breast cancer patients who cannot afford basic needs like utility payments, rent, groceries, transportation or office visit co-pays. Susan G. Komen for the Cure is the world’s largest breast cancer organization, and the Komen Denver Affiliate is one of 125 Affiliates on the front lines dedicated to ending breast cancer in their communities. Komen Affiliates fund innovative programs that help women and men overcome the cultural, social, educational and financial barriers to breast cancer screening and treatment. “The Raymond Wentz Foundation will provide financial support to medically underserved breast cancer patients, and the Komen Denver Affiliate is proud to work in partnership with them,” said Michele Ostrander, Executive Director.

About Susan G. Komen for the Cure® and the Komen Denver Affiliate Nancy G. Brinker promised her dying sister, Susan G. Komen, she would do everything in her power to end breast cancer forever, and in 1982, that promise became Susan G. Komen for the Cure. The Denver Affiliate is part of the world’s largest and most progressive grassroots network fighting breast cancer. Through events like the Komen Denver Race for the Cure and thePink Tie Affair, the Affiliate has invested $23 million in community breast cancer programs in their 12-county service area. Up to 75 percent of net proceeds generated by the Affiliate stays in the local community. The remaining 25 percent funds national breast cancer research.
